The price of NVIDIA graphics cards is starting to fall in Germany. In fact, NVIDIA’s three latest launches, the RTX 40 Super, are below the brand’s MSRP in Germany.

The launch of these Super cards was followed by a series of price adjustments.

Now we’re interested in the cards’ current prices. As a reminder, the 4070 Super was launched at €659, compared with €889 for the RTX 4070 Ti Super. Finally, the RTX 4090 Super suffered a price cut compared to the original 4080 , which didn’t sell. Its MSRP was €1109 at launch.

Thanks to ComputerBase, a German media outlet, we now know that these cards are gradually slipping below NVIDIA’s suggested retail price. The small 4070S can currently be found at €589, while the 4070 Ti Super is priced at €840. Only the 4080S remains, at €1092.

Here in France, after a brief search, it turns out that only Zotac’s RTX 4070 Super Twin Edge is available under its MSRP.
